This park is great pretty much any season except winter! There are flush washrooms open during daylight hours May-October, and a port-a-potty during winter. (Though the city might want to rethink that, as the port-a-potty had snow inside it when we were there this winter) The play structure and beach are clean and in good repair. There's an area to get small boats/windsurfing boards intl the water, a little grassy area ideal for picnics or soccer, lots of parking for the small size of the park. No dogs allowed, so not ideal for pet owners. Great park with beautiful waterfront views!

Very nice park and beach area. The area has quite a few trees, so there is shaded areas. There are picnic tables available and benches to sit on. The beach area is a little rocky and closer to the water has a lot of zebra mussels on the beach, so keeping sandals on or having swim shoes is a must. Overall, it's a fun area to bring the kids to play and to picnic. Plus, the resident parking passes are good to use at this location, so that's always good.
